Description

From tales of Cleopatra and King Tut, Egypt has fascinated travelers for centuries. On this 7-night vacation, get a crash course on Egyptian culture and history as you explore the country's most iconic sites. 

Fly into Cairo and spend two nights in Egypt's vibrant capital. On a full-day tour, see a bustling bazaar, fascinating museum, the Pyramids of Giza and the Sphinx - two monuments at the top of almost every traveler's bucket list. 

You'll then fly to Luxor for your 4-night cruise of the Nile, Egypt's lifeline. Aboard a luxurious ship, cruise the famous river and explore the famous temples and tombs that straddle it: Luxor, Karnak, Kom Ombo and Edfu. Your trip ends in Cairo, where you'll have one night to experience the city on your own.

Itinerary: Explore Egypt: Cairo & Nile River Cruise

Day 1 Welcome to Cairo!

Say hello to Egypt's capital, Cairo! Upon arrival, you will be welcomed and assisted through immigration and customs by a representative who will be holding a sign with your name. After transferring to your hotel, enjoy the remainder of your day at leisure.

Day 2 Cairo

Enjoy a full-day tour taking you to a handful of Cairo's iconic sights including the Pyramids of Giza, the Sphinx, the Egyptian Museum and the Khan el-Khalili bazaar. 

Day 3 Cairo - Nile River Cruise

Today, transfer to Cairo airport for your flight to Luxor. Upon arrival in Luxor, meet a representative and transfer to your Nile Cruise. Settle into your room and enjoy lunch on board. After lunch, enjoy a half-day tour taking you to the Karnak and Luxor temples! 

Day 4 Nile River Cruise

Wake up to the glittering Nile River, enjoy breakfast on board, then take a tour of the Valley of the Kings, the temple of Hatshepsut and the Colossi of Memnon. Return to the ship for lunch as you sail towards Edfu. 

Day 5 Nile River Cruise

Today, visit the Temple of Edfu, the most well-preserved temple of Ancient Egypt, renowned for its gigantic pylons. You'll also visit the Temple of Kom Ombo, dedicated to Sobek the crocodile god, and Horus the falcon-headed god. After your tour, have lunch on board and sail to Aswan. 

Day 6 Nile River Cruise

In Aswan, explore the High Dam, constructed in the 1960s to tame the mighty waters of the Nile, and Philae Temple, one of Nubia's most important monument sites. You'll also get to experience sailing on a felucca, a traditional sailboat used on the Nile.

Day 7 Nile River Cruise - Cairo

Your Nile Cruise ends today. Head to Aswan airport for your flight to Cairo where you will spend your final night. The rest of the day is yours to explore on your own - you might want to check out Cairo Citadel or the Mosque of Muhammed Ali. 

Day 8 Depart Egypt

Your Egypt vacation ends today. At the appropriate time, you'll be transferred to Cairo airport for your flight home.

Itinerary: Classic Alexandria Mini Adventure

Day 1 Cairo

Meet your fellow travellers and CEO for a welcome briefing at 12:30pm before heading out to explore the city. We'll head first to ancient Coptic Cairo, where we visit the Hanging Church, St Sergius Church, and Ben Ezra Synagogue. Continue to Islamic Cairo with visits to the Citadel and Mohamed Ali mosque. Take a felucca ride on the Nile before heading to downtown Cairo for a foodie tour.

Please ensure your arrival flights lands at the Cairo airport no later than 9:30am on Day 1. The tour starts at 12:30PM in the lobby of the joining hotel. We recommend booking a pre-night in Cairo to ensure you do not miss any activities this day.

Day 2 Cairo/Alexandria

Travel to Alexandria, stopping to visit the Monasteries of Wadi Natrun en route. Founded by Alexander the Great around 331BC, Alexandria is Egypt's only Mediterranean city with a distinctly European atmosphere. After a seafood lunch, head to the fort and citadel of Qaitbay, and the new Alexandria Library.

Day 3 Alexandria/Cairo

Continue exploring this beautiful city with a walk through the Montazah Summer Palace gardens and a visit to the ancient Roman theatre. Gaze up at Pompey's Pillar and explore the underground catacombs of Kom El Shoqafa. Enjoy lunch then travel back to Cairo where the tour ends.

This tour ends at approx. 5PM at the Cairo hotel.
